Webstandard Shape Codes. * Use shape code 99 for all other shapes. A dimensional sketch of the shape. shall be given in the Bending Schedule. * Dimensions are all external (outside. Dimensions). * Radii of all bends are standard, unless "R" is given in the bending schedule. WebWith Rebar shape manager you can establish your own rules for defining the bending shapes. When you define your own reinforcing bar bending shapes and shape codes, an .xml file called RebarShapeRules.xml is created in the current model folder.
